Seals and rubber stamps in schools authenticate certificates, letters and documents. Observations reveal that they feature school names, emblems and dates, ensuring authenticity, preventing forgery and reinforcing institutional credibility in academic records. Seals represent an institution’s authority, credibility and identity. They authenticate documents, reinforce branding and ensure legal validity, commonly used in government offices, businesses and educational institutions for official approvals.
